Two California men sold drugs and weapons using an encrypted messaging service and shipped the contraband to New Jersey in a scheme that was foiled by undercover U.S. Postal inspectors, authorities said Wednesday. Angelo Chavez, 22, of Stockton, and Phillip Luevano, 21, of Manteca, were arrested Tuesday in California, according to the New Jersey U.S. Attorney’s Office. Both men operated channels on the Telegram app that offered narcotics, including heroin and opioid pills, for sale, using names including “TMO Drug Menu” and “@IllPhil’s Drug Menu,” according to a criminal complaint filed in the…
